Magistrate Orders Woman Held Without Bond In Child-For-Sale Case

SAN ANTONIO (AP) – A federal magistrate has ordered a mother accused of attempting to prostitute her young daughters held without bond.

Magistrate Nancy Stein Nowak ordered 25-year-old Jennifer Richards to remain in custody Tuesday after hearing testimony from an FBI agent in the case. The agent said Richards and a boyfriend had extensively chatted over the Internet about how to sell Richards’ 5-year-old daughter to a child molester. The two also allegedly discussed how to condition the girl to accept the abuse.

Richards also has a 10-month-old girl that authorities allege she planned to prostitute when the child was older.

Richards began to cry numerous times during the hearing.

Her attorney says the chats were nothing but fantasy, prompted by her boyfriend who is also charged in the case.
